In the century since Nobel Laureate Elie Metchnikoff first developed the use of beneficial bacteria to bolster human health, researchers have identified hundreds of probiotic species, but one stands apart from the other in terms of viability and efficacy: Bacillus Coagulans. This extraordinary probiotic was first identified in 1933 and demonstrates unique spore-forming capabilities, which give it some distinct advantages over other probiotic species.
In its spore phase, this bacterium is able to withstand higher temperatures than common probiotics like L. acidophilus, which greatly increases its shelf- life and eliminates the need for refrigeration. Plus, in spore form the organisms are protected from degradation by stomach acids, enabling them to reach the lower GI tract intact—something many others fail to achieve. Once there, they become active lactic acid producing probiotics, helping to maintain a healthy microbial balance for comfortable gastrointestinal function.

Unlike many probiotics that belong to the Lactobacillus or Bifidobacterium groups, Bacillus coagulans is a spore-forming probiotic. This unique characteristic helps protect the probiotic organism and contributes to its stability. Bacillus coagulans is commonly chosen by individuals seeking digestive support from a resilient probiotic strain. - What Is a Spore-Forming Probiotic?
A spore-forming probiotic is a type of beneficial microorganism that naturally forms a protective outer shell, or spore. This protective structure helps the probiotic remain stable under a variety of environmental conditions. Bacillus coagulans is a spore-forming probiotic, which contributes to its durability and makes it a popular choice in probiotic supplements. - What Are CFUs in Bacillus coagulans Supplements?
CFU stands for Colony Forming Units, a measurement used to indicate the number of viable probiotic microorganisms in a supplement. In Bacillus coagulans products, the CFU count represents the amount of beneficial probiotic bacteria provided per serving. CFUs help consumers understand the potency of a probiotic supplement and the quantity of live microorganisms it delivers. - Does Swanson Probiotics Bacillus Coagulans Need Refrigeration?
